Requirements for Students
To be eligible for the Civic Fellows Program, students must meet the following requirements:
- Be in good academic standing with George Mason University
- Commit to 8-10 hours of service at their partner site
- Attend bi-weekly meetings of the Civic Fellows program and participate in any activities of the program
- Attend the Civic Fellows Orientation
Application Process
The application process for the Civic Fellows Program consists of two rounds:
- First Round: The Application
- The application is available on August 1st via Handshake
- Students must submit their rťsumťs and complete a Student Information Form
- The application closes on August 31st
- On September 1st, chosen applicants will be emailed a sign-up link for two days of interviews with Community Partners
- Second Round: The Interviews
- Interviews take place on September 11th and 12th via Zoom
- This is an opportunity for potential Fellows to ask organizations about partner expectations, tasks, location, and other questions
- Following interviews, students will note their top 3 Partner choices
Selection and Placement
- The first round of students will be notified about their Community Partner matches by September 19th
- The second round of students will be contacted on September 24
- The mandatory 2025 Civic Fellow Orientation will be on October 3rd
- Placements begin on October 5th
